Our Research Methodology
We evaluated car technology ecommerce websites based on three core criteria: user experience (UX) patterns, merchandising clarity, and overall execution quality. UX patterns included intuitive navigation, filtering options, and mobile responsiveness. Merchandising clarity assessed how well product benefits and specifications were communicated, while execution quality focused on website speed, reliability, and trust indicators such as detailed reviews and technical support resources. The rankings reflect a comparative analysis rather than definitive endorsements, emphasizing specialty focus and execution maturity.
Crutchfield
Crutchfield stands out for its specialty in car audio and video technology, providing a deeply focused and well-organized catalog that addresses advanced buyer needs. The site employs clear product categorizations, compatibility checkers, and comprehensive buying guides, which enhance buyer confidence. Its clean, responsive design aids navigation while offering rich technical resources, fostering trust and an expert impression.

What Store Owners Can Learn From These Websites
Store owners can draw inspiration from these websites by prioritizing clear product categorizations aligned with specific technology needs, employing compatibility tools, and providing educational content that supports informed decision-making. Streamlined navigation, responsive design, and offering multiple content types (videos, guides, manuals) enhance user experience and buyer confidence. Specialty focus and transparent technical information tailored to a discerning audience stand out as key patterns to adapt.
